Manager Legal Real Estate

Business Area

Lease and Licensing

About this role

As the Manager Legal Real Estate, your primary responsibility is to handle all legal aspects related to real estate. You will be responsible for drafting, negotiating, and reviewing various legal documents pertaining to real estate transactions.

Your key role will involve ensuring compliance with state and local laws, identifying and mitigating legal risks, coordinating with external law firms, and providing legal advice and opinions on real estate matters.

Additionally, you will be responsible for maintaining a repository of lease documents, representing the company in court for real estate matters, and actively participating in discussions regarding lease and real estate purchases.

Key Skills

  • In-depth understanding of state and local laws governing real estate in the relevant jurisdiction(s).
  • Strong knowledge of laws and regulations pertaining to the real estate industry.
  • Familiarity with real estate concepts such as property management, sales transactions, and leasing.
  • Excellent analytical and critical thinking skills.
  • Effective time management and organizational abilities.
  • Exceptional communication and negotiation skills, with the ability to manage stakeholders effectively.
  • Detail-oriented individual with a high level of motivation and professionalism.
  • Ability to maintain confidentiality of sensitive information.

Qualifications

  • Experience in handling real estate litigation and legal requirements.
  • Proven work experience as a Real Estate Lawyer, Legal Advisor, or in a similar legal position in the real estate industry.
  • LLB graduate with a minimum of 8 years of experience in real estate, preferably with a reputed law firm or a large, diversified company.
  • Bachelor’s degree in Law or a related field.
